Author: Clair Geary

Clair is a freshly minted PhD in Immunology and Microbial Pathogenesis from Weill Cornell Graduate School, where her thesis research explored natural killer cell responses to viral infection. She is a 2020 Mirzayan Science & Technology Policy Fellow working with the Board on Science Education at the National Academies, and in her free time enjoys crossword puzzles, being out in nature, and baking.
